Hungary – Repair and maintenance services of central heating – Nyírbátor Város távhőszolgáltatás ellátása

Description

The operation and management of the district heating production and supply system (heating plant, pipeline network, heat substations, etc.) of Nyírbátor city, through the establishment of a concession company for a 25-year period. The subject of the concession contract to be procured is the operation, maintenance, repair, procurement of energy carriers, billing, revenue collection, handling of arrears, customer service operation, sending mandatory reports to authorities, and data provision to the e-government system of the district heating system. The Concession Contract shall be concluded by the Inviting Entity with the winning bidder, who shall be referred to as the "Concessionaire" in the Concession Contract. The Concessionaire is obliged to establish the "Concession Company" within 90 days from the signing of the contract. The Concession Company shall, within 30 days from its establishment, apply to the Hungarian Energy and Public Utility Regulatory Office. From the date of obtaining the license (usually January 1st of the year or, in case of a mid-year change, October 1st of the year in question), the Concessionaire shall transfer the rights and obligations arising from the Concession Contract to the Concession Company. The basis for the concession fee (based on information from the MEKH) is the future depreciation of the public utility asset. The expected amount of the concession fee for the next 25 years can be determined based on an examination of the tangible assets of the district heating system public utility (municipal and currently operated by Nyírbátori Városfejlesztő és Működtető Kft. owned equipment).
